Free Online Course: Capitalism vs. Socialism: Comparing Economic Systems provided by The Great Courses Plus is a comprehensive online course, which lasts for 12 hours worth of material. The course is taught in English and is free of charge. Capitalism vs. Socialism: Comparing Economic Systems is taught by Edward F. Stuart, PhD.

Overview
  • Professor Emeritus Edward F. Stuart takes you across three centuries to chart the history of modern economic thought and practice around the world.
